Description

Lake Pointe in Lake Saint Louis, MO is an assisted living community that offers a variety of care options including Independent Living, Memory Care, and Respite Care. The community is equipped with numerous amenities to provide residents with a comfortable living experience. Each apartment comes fully furnished and includes cable or satellite TV, a kitchenette for personal use, and Wi-Fi/high-speed internet access for staying connected. Housekeeping services are provided to ensure a clean and organized living space.

Residents can enjoy delicious meals in the dining room where restaurant-style dining is offered. Special dietary restrictions can be accommodated to cater to individual needs. For leisurely activities, there is a small library on-site as well as resident-run activities and scheduled daily activities to keep everyone engaged and entertained.

Safety and well-being are prioritized at Lake Pointe. There is a 24-hour call system and 24-hour supervision provided by attentive staff who are available to assist with activities of daily living such as bathing, dressing, and transfers. Medication management ensures that residents receive their prescribed medications on time.

For those requiring memory care, Lake Pointe offers specialized programming tailored to individuals with mild cognitive impairment. Additionally, a mental wellness program is in place to promote emotional well-being.

    Dementia, influenced by aging and certain medications, may be exacerbated by drug classes such as anticholinergics, benzodiazepines, and antipsychotics, which are associated with cognitive impairment. Regular medication reviews by healthcare professionals are crucial for older adults to manage risks and optimize cognitive health.

    Dementia often results in disrupted sleep patterns, leading to excessive daytime sleeping due to factors like brain damage affecting circadian rhythms, medication side effects, and lack of structure in daily activities. Caregivers must monitor these changes closely, as oversleeping can increase risks such as malnutrition or dehydration, and provide necessary support and routines to enhance patient engagement and well-being.

    The transition from assisted living to skilled nursing care is often prompted by complex medical needs that assisted living cannot meet, with key indicators including frequent health declines, increased falls, severe memory issues, and caregiver burnout. Families should recognize these signs early to discuss options with healthcare providers and prepare for the emotional and logistical aspects of moving to a facility that offers comprehensive medical support.
